摘要 In an earth-scraping implement of the transversely elongated type supported by laterally spaced wheels which can be vertically moved to raise and lower the implement, the wheels are mounted on arms affixed to and projecting from a transverse rockshaft formed of two parts, one of which can be angularly adjusted relative to the other to level the bowl and scraper blade.

In an implement having a frame adapted for connection to a tractor, transverse shaft means rockably mounted on the frame, laterally spaced wheel-carrying arms mounted on a shaft means, power-operated means mounted on a frame and having a connection with said shaft means for rocking the latter to swing said wheelcarrying arms vertically between positions corresponding to the operating and transport positions of the implement, an angular adjustment means operable independently of said power-operated means for angularly adjusting one of said wheel-carrying arms about the axis of said shaft means relative to the other of said wheel-carrying arms and holding said arms in a selected adjusted position to Level the implement, said shaft means including a pair of aligned wheel-carrying sections rockably mounted on the frame to which said wheelcarrying arms are secured and a lever secured to the inner end of each of said sections, means being provided for operatively connecting the power-operated means to said levers for rocking said wheel-carrying sections simultaneously, adjustable means forming the connection between the power-operated means in one of said levers to angularly adjust said one of said levers relative to the other and thereby vary the vertical positions of said wheel-carrying arms, and wherein a floating arm is mounted on the axis of said shaft means for pivoting relative thereto, pin means forming a connection between said levers and said floating arm, the connection of said pin means to said one of said levers including means for accommodating angular movement of said one of said levers relative to the other, and said adjustable means being connected between said one of said levers and said floating arm.
2. The invention set forth in claim 1, wherein a slot is provided in said one of said levers to receive said pin and the adjustable means shifts the position of the pin in said slot to angularly adjust one of said shaft sections relative to the other.
3. The invention set forth in claim 2, wherein said shaft means includes a central section on which the inner ends of said wheel-carrying sections are rockably mounted and said floating arm is pivotally mounted on the central section between the levers on said wheel-carrying sections.
